MySQL图形界面操作指南
mysql 图形界面

首页 2025-06-25 17:17:02



MySQL图形界面:提升数据库管理效率的强大工具 在当今信息化快速发展的时代,数据库管理成为了企业运营不可或缺的一部分

    MySQL,作为开源数据库管理系统中的佼佼者,凭借其稳定性、高性能和广泛的社区支持,赢得了众多开发者和企业的青睐

    然而,仅凭MySQL的命令行界面(CLI)进行数据库管理,对于许多用户来说可能显得繁琐且低效

    这时,MySQL图形界面(GUI)工具的出现,无疑为数据库管理带来了革命性的变化

    本文将深入探讨MySQL图形界面的优势、常用工具及其在实际应用中的强大功能,以期说服广大数据库管理员和开发者采用这一高效的管理方式

     一、MySQL图形界面的优势 1. 直观易用的操作界面 相较于命令行界面,MySQL图形界面提供了更为直观的操作界面

    用户无需记忆复杂的SQL命令,只需通过点击、拖拽等简单操作即可完成数据库的创建、修改、查询等操作

    这不仅降低了学习成本,还大大提高了工作效率

     2. 强大的可视化功能 MySQL图形界面工具通常配备了丰富的可视化功能,如数据表结构视图、数据关系图、查询结果网格等

    这些功能使得数据库的结构和数据关系一目了然,有助于用户更好地理解和分析数据库

     3. 支持多种数据库操作 图形界面工具不仅支持基本的数据库创建、删除、备份和恢复操作,还支持复杂的查询优化、事务管理、用户权限设置等功能

    这些功能的集成,使得用户无需切换多个工具即可完成全面的数据库管理

     4. 跨平台兼容性 多数MySQL图形界面工具都支持Windows、Linux、macOS等主流操作系统,实现了跨平台的兼容性

    这意味着用户无论在哪个平台上工作,都能享受到一致的操作体验

     二、常用MySQL图形界面工具 1. phpMyAdmin phpMyAdmin是一款基于Web的MySQL管理工具,它提供了丰富的数据库管理功能,包括数据库设计、数据导入导出、用户权限管理等

    phpMyAdmin以其简洁的界面和强大的功能,成为了许多Web开发者的首选工具

    此外,它还支持多种语言,方便国际用户使用

     2. MySQL Workbench MySQL Workbench是官方提供的集成开发环境(IDE),专为MySQL数据库设计

    它提供了数据库设计、建模、SQL开发、服务器配置、用户管理等全方位的功能

    MySQL Workbench还支持数据迁移、备份恢复和性能监控等高级功能,是数据库管理员和开发者不可或缺的工具

     3. Navicat Navicat是一款功能强大的数据库管理工具,支持MySQL、MariaDB、SQLite、Oracle等多种数据库

    它提供了直观的图形界面,方便用户进行数据库设计、数据迁移、备份恢复等操作

    Navicat还支持数据同步、自动化任务调度等高级功能,极大地提高了数据库管理的效率

     4. DBeaver DBeaver是一款通用的数据库管理工具,支持MySQL、PostgreSQL、SQLite、Oracle等多种数据库

    它提供了丰富的数据库管理功能,包括SQL编辑器、数据导入导出、数据库设计器等

    DBeaver还支持数据库连接池、事务管理、用户权限设置等高级功能,是跨数据库管理的理想选择

     三、MySQL图形界面的实际应用 1. 数据库设计与建模 在数据库设计阶段,MySQL图形界面工具提供了直观的数据库设计器,允许用户通过拖拽表、字段和关系来构建数据库模型

    这些工具还支持自动生成SQL脚本,方便用户将设计好的数据库模型导入到数据库中

     2. 数据导入与导出 MySQL图形界面工具通常支持多种数据格式的导入与导出,如CSV、Excel、JSON等

    这使得用户能够轻松地将数据从其他系统或文件中导入到MySQL数据库中,或将数据库中的数据导出到其他格式进行进一步的分析和处理

     3. 查询优化与性能监控 对于复杂的查询,MySQL图形界面工具提供了查询分析器,帮助用户识别和优化查询中的瓶颈

    此外,这些工具还支持性能监控功能,能够实时显示数据库的运行状态和资源使用情况,帮助用户及时发现并解决性能问题

     4. 用户权限管理 MySQL图形界面工具提供了用户权限管理功能,允许用户轻松地为不同的数据库用户分配不同的权限

    这有助于确保数据库的安全性,防止未经授权的访问和数据泄露

     5. 自动化任务调度 一些高级的MySQL图形界面工具还支持自动化任务调度功能

    用户可以设置定时任务,如定期备份数据库、自动清理过期数据等

    这些自动化任务能够大大减轻数据库管理员的工作负担,提高数据库的可靠性和稳定性

     四、案例分析:MySQL图形界面在企业管理中的应用 以某电商企业为例,该企业拥有庞大的用户数据和交易数据,需要高效的数据库管理系统来支持其日常运营

    在采用MySQL图形界面工具之前,该企业的数据库管理员主要通过命令行界面进行数据库管理,这不仅效率低下,还容易出错

    随着业务的不断增长,数据库管理的复杂度也在不断增加,管理员逐渐感到力不从心

     为了解决这个问题,该企业引入了MySQL Workbench作为主要的数据库管理工具

    通过MySQL Workbench,管理员能够直观地查看和管理数据库结构,快速执行复杂的查询和优化任务

    此外,MySQL Workbench还支持自动化备份和恢复功能,确保了数据的安全性和可靠性

     经过一段时间的使用,该企业发现数据库管理的效率得到了显著提升

    管理员能够更快地响应业务需求,减少了因数据库管理不当而导致的业务中断

    同时,MySQL Workbench的可视化功能也帮助管理员更好地理解了数据库的结构和数据关系,为企业的数据分析和决策提供了有力支持

     五、结论 综上所述,MySQL图形界面工具以其直观易用的操作界面、强大的可视化功能、支持多种数据库操作和跨平台兼容性等优势,成为了数据库管理员和开发者的得力助手

    通过采用这些工具,用户可以显著提高数据库管理的效率和质量,降低管理成本,确保数据库的安全性和可靠性

     在当今信息化快速发展的时代,选择一款合适的MySQL图形界面工具对于企业的数据库管理至关重要

    无论是phpMyAdmin的简洁易用、MySQL Workbench的全方位功能、Navicat的跨数据库支持还是DBea

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道